WHAT IS THE MAPBIOMAS BOLIVIA INITIATIVE?

The "Annual Land Cover and Use Mapping in Bolivia" Project is an initiative that involves a collaborative network of specialists in remote sensing, GIS, and programming experts. It uses cloud processing and automated classifiers developed and operated from the Google Earth Engine platform to generate a historical series of annual land cover and use maps of Bolivia.

ORIGIN

The Fundación Amigos de la Naturaleza (FAN), is a member of the Amazonian Network of Red Amazónica de Información Socioambiental Georreferenciada (RAISG), where this type of information is generated in a coordinated manner with other countries in the basin to achieve the same objectives. Since 2009, as part of the work with RAISG, the construction of deforestation maps of the Bolivian Amazon using increasingly advanced satellite data processing tools began. In search of new alternatives for process automation and timely information generation, in March 2017, RAISG, in agreement with the General Coordination of MapBiomas Network, created the MapBiomas Amazonia initiative, of which FAN is a member. As part of the work with RAISG and MapBiomas, FAN has achieved the First Collection of Annual Land Cover and Use Maps for the entire Bolivian territory for the period 1985-2021. Thanks to this collaborative effort, these maps will be available on an interactive platform for the MapBiomas Bolivia initiative.

PURPOSE

To contribute to the understanding of land use dynamics in Bolivia based on the development and implementation of a fast, reliable, and low-cost methodology to generate annual maps of land cover and land use from 1985 to the present (and updated annually thereafter).
Creation of a web platform to facilitate the dissemination of the methodology and access to results: Products and Sub-products.
Establishment of a collaborative network of specialists in the countries for mapping land cover and land use and change dynamics.

CHARACTERISTICS OF THE INITIATIVE

Network collaboration with the responsible institutions of different countries.
Distributed and automated data processing through an alliance with Google Earth Engine.
Work aimed at generating an open and replicable platform.
Collaborative platform designed to incorporate and welcome contributions from the scientific community interested in collaborating.
